Five-Directional CNC Fabrication: Excelling in Challenging Geometries

Multi-axis CNC processing embodies a significant advancement in cutting-edge manufacturing systems, facilitating the fabrication of parts with impressive geometric refinement. Unlike classic 3-axis systems, which only travel in three one-dimensional directions, these devices utilize rotational angles, yielding the potential to machine traits from numerous angles at once. This capacity is distinctively advantageous for clinical applications, pattern making, and any industries expecting exceptionally exact and detailed geometric contours.

Main Gains of using 5-axis machining comprise:

  • Decreased setup times
  • Boosted precision
  • Enhanced design latitude
  • Competence to craft undercuts
  • Lowered number of holders
